Artist's Description

When I was a little girl living in Massachusetts we used to visit a local zoo, one of the exhibits
was a polar bear named "Snowball" visiting him was the highlight of the trip everytime.

About Camille Lopez

Camille Lopez

I was born in Massachusetts, moved to Kansas as a young teen, and now reside in sunny California. I first was introduced to photography as a very young child. My mother was a freelance photographer with a darkroom of her own, I used to help her develop her work. The dawning of the computer age opened my eyes to scanning photographs onto my computer and editing them. The arrival of the digital camera excited my passion for beauty. I soon found myself needing to capture the essence of the environment in which I found myself. The digital camera allowed me to hone my skill in recreating what I saw in my minds eye.
